Beware the Whispering Woods
In misty woods where shadows breathe,
Bark-bound forms in silence seethe,
Moss-clad guardians, dark and deep,
Through fog and leaf, their secrets keep.
Their hollow eyes, a twilight glow,
Roots entwined where whispers grow,
With every step, the forest sighs,
Beware the gaze of ancient eyes.
Tread lightly here, where echoes cling,
Through haunted groves, where spirits sing,
For those who stray in shadowed light,
May join the woods before the night.
